993 heat exchanger project
Well after a lot of thought I embarked a project which I hope was worth while. this is a mix between stock 993 heat exchangers and my fabbed 321 stainless y. Any thoughts? This was designed with thought of how not to have it crack.

My thoughts:
Pros
- should have oem durability
- twin wastegate design should eliminate overboost situations
- short runs to turbo should help to reduce lag
- gorgeous welds...(these are brought to us by Ben at M&K)
- good pricing as reflected on the "other" forum
Cons
- less than ideal collector design.
- large primary size may reduce exhaust gas velocity
I think they look great. Cannot wait to see the dyno results from rarlyl8.
